Ore extensions and Poisson algebras
Abstract
For a derivation d of a commutative Noetherian complex algebra A, a homeomorphism is established between the prime spectrum of the Ore extension A[z;d] and the Poisson prime spectrum of the polynomial algebra A[z] endowed with the Poisson bracket such that A,A=0 and z,a=d(a) for all a in A. Several illustrative examples are discussed including some where A is known to be d-simple.
